It is not uncommon to experience some spotting in early pregnancy. Often this bleeding is associated with the implantation of the embryo in the uterine wall. Some women experience spotting early in their pregnancy at the time their period would be due. This bleeding is caused by the hormone levels not being high enough to completely suppress their period. However, I always recommend speaking with your doctor if you are experiencing cramping or bleeding during your pregnancy. It is difficult to determine for yourself if the symptoms you are experiencing are something to be concerned about. Your doctor will be aware of your health and history. Using that information your doctor will be able to determine if you should be examined.
